Florence never let their opponents score on Friday. They walked away with a 5-0 win over the Desert Christian Eagles. That's more bragging rights for the Gophers, who also won the pair's last head-to-head.

Wyatt Stenson was incredible, scoring two runs and stealing two bases while going 2-for-2. He has become a key player for Florence: the team is undefeated when he posts at least two runs, but 5-6 otherwise. Another player making a difference was Adrian Rodriguez, who got on base in all four of his plate appearances with one double and one RBI.
Florence hit smart and finished the game with only two strikeouts. The team has now struck out at least two batters in three consecutive matchups.
Florence has been performing well recently as they've won three of their last four cont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 12-6 record this season. Those victories came thanks in part to their pitching effort, having only surrendered 1.5 runs on average over those games. As for Desert Christian, their defeat dropped their record down to 6-9.
Florence has already played their next game, a 3-3 tie against Williams on the 12th. As for Desert Christian, they also wasted no time getting back out on the field and have already played their next matchup, an 8-7 win against Valley Union on the 12th.
